Основания HTML и CSS для новичков

Основания HTML и CSS для новичков

Основания HTML и CSS для новичков

HTML и CSS являются собой основополагающие средства веб-разработки. HTML ответственен за структуру и контент страницы, а CSS контролирует зрительным дизайном элементов. Изучение этих языков предоставляет возможность к созданию ресурсов.

HTML расшифровывается как HyperText Markup Language. Язык разметки задействует теги для определения типа материала. Браузер распознаёт теги и показывает контент согласно установленной структуре.

CSS обозначает Cascading Style Sheets. Каскадные таблицы стилей дают разграничить контент и отображение. Разработчик может модифицировать визуальный вид всего ресурса, изменив единственный файл стилей.

Овладение рокс казино предполагает поэтапного способа. Начинающим рекомендуется изначально усвоить фундаментальные теги разметки. После осознания организации документа можно приступать к оформлению элементов.

Нынешние браузеры обеспечивают современные стандарты языков. Инструменты разработчика интегрированы в Chrome, Firefox и другие приложения. Консоль браузера способствует тестировать код и изучать rox casino на практических образцах.

Структура HTML‑документа: doctype, head, body и основной образец страницы

Каждый HTML-документ стартует с объявления DOCTYPE. Декларация сообщает браузеру версию языка разметки. Нынешние страницы применяютhtmlдля определения спецификации HTML5.

Главный элемент html оборачивает всё наполнение документа. Атрибут lang задаёт язык страницы для поисковых систем. Верное задание языка улучшает доступность и сканирование сайта.

Блок head содержит метаинформацию о странице. Внутри размещаются теги meta, title, link для подсоединения стилей. Кодировка UTF-8 предоставляет правильное показ символов. Название title показывается во закладке браузера и итогах поиска.

Элемент body включает весь отображаемый содержимое страницы. Пользователь наблюдает лишь содержимое этого блока в окне браузера. Программисты размещают текст, изображения, формы внутри казино рокс.

Базовый образец страницы является отправной основой для разработок. Валидная структура обеспечивает совместимость с различными браузерами. Корректная организация кода облегчает последующую разработку и обслуживание.

Главные HTML‑теги: заголовки, параграфы, линки, картинки и перечни

Названия от h1 до h6 организуют структуру содержимого на странице. Тег h1 обозначает основной заголовок и употребляется один раз. Следующие уровни образуют иерархическую структуру блоков. Поисковые системы анализируют названия для определения тематики.

Тег p формирует текстовые параграфы и является основным элементом для размещения данных. Браузер автоматически добавляет интервалы сверху и снизу. Деление текста на параграфы повышает удобочитаемость.

Ссылки создаются тегом a с требуемым атрибутом href. Адрес может вести на внешний ресурс или метку внутри страницы. Атрибут target со параметром _blank запускает линк в новой закладке.

Тег img встраивает изображения в документ. Атрибут src хранит путь к файлу рисунка. Альтернативный текст в атрибуте alt описывает рисунок для рокс казино и поддерживающих инструментов.

Неупорядоченные перечни ul хранят элементы li без заданного порядка. Упорядоченные списки ol выводят пункты с цифрами. Списки помогают упорядочить данные в доступном виде для понимания.

Смысловая структура: header, nav, main, section, article, footer

Смысловые теги придают содержательное значение элементам страницы. Браузеры и поисковые системы лучше распознают организацию документа. Использование правильных тегов улучшает доступность для пользователей с ограниченными способностями.

Тег header обозначает вводную часть страницы или блока. Внутри располагается логотип, меню, название ресурса. Каждая страница может иметь множество элементов header.

Элемент nav предназначен для навигационных линков. Меню портала, содержание, хлебные крошки размещаются внутри этого тега. Скринридеры используют nav для оперативного перемещения по rox casino.

Главные семантические контейнеры:

  • main хранит эксклюзивный содержимое страницы
  • section собирает смыслово связанное содержимое
  • article являет самостоятельную публикацию
  • footer включает информацию об создателе, копирайт, контакты

Корректная смысловая структура формирует стройную структуру документа. Поисковые роботы продуктивнее индексируют страницы с значимыми тегами. Программисты проще разбираются в коде при употреблении смысловых элементов.

Что такое CSS: подключение стилей и основные селекторы (элемент, класс, id)

CSS определяет зрительное отображение HTML-элементов на странице. Каскадные таблицы стилей позволяют контролировать цветом, размером, позиционированием контента. Отделение стилизации и организации упрощает создание проекта.

Имеется три способа подсоединения стилей к документу. Внешний файл CSS присоединяется через тег link в блоке head. Внутренние стили размещаются в теге style. Встроенные стили прописываются в атрибут style элемента.

Селектор элемента отбирает все теги конкретного типа на странице. Запись p color: blue; установит синий цвет ко всем параграфам. Такой подход эффективен для глобального оформления.

Классы позволяют форматировать совокупность элементов с единообразными свойствами. Атрибут class присваивается тегам, а в рокс казино выборщик начинается с точки. Один элемент может включать множество классов через пространство.

Идентификатор id указывает уникальный элемент на странице. Селектор id стартует с символа решётки в таблице стилей. Каждый идентификатор применяется лишь один раз в документе. Вес стилей id выше, чем у классов и выборщиков элементов.

Основные атрибуты CSS: цвет, шрифты, отбивки и работа с текстом

Параметр color задаёт цвет текста элемента. Параметры прописываются в видах hex, rgb, rgba или именами оттенков. Свойство background-color определяет задний цвет элемента. Корректный соотношение повышает восприятие материала.

Семейство гарнитур устанавливается через font-family. Рекомендуется указывать несколько вариантов через запятую. Браузер подберёт начальный имеющийся шрифт из списка. Величина текста регулируется параметром font-size в пикселях или процентах.

Параметр font-weight регулирует насыщенностью гарнитуры. Величины прописываются цифрами от 100 до 900 или ключевыми normal и bold. Наклонное оформление активируется через font-style со параметром italic.

Выравнивание текста определяется атрибутом text-align с значениями left, right, center, justify. Интерлиньяж расстояние регулируется через line-height. Оформление текста text-decoration создаёт подчёркивание или зачёркивание в казино рокс.

Внешние отбивки margin создают пространство вокруг элемента. Внутренние отступы padding образуют расстояние между рамкой и наполнением. Значения задаются для всех сторон одновременно или раздельно для каждой края.

Схема блока (box model): content, padding, border, margin и обводки

Модель бокса характеризует построение каждого элемента на веб-странице. Каждый блок состоит из четырёх зон: содержимого, внутреннего отбивки, обводки и внешнего отбивки. Усвоение модели важно для контроля габаритами элементов.

Область content содержит фактическое наполнение: текст, рисунки или вложенные блоки. Ширина и высота определяются параметрами width и height. По дефолту эти свойства определяют исключительно размер содержимого.

Внутренний интервал padding создаёт промежуток между контентом и рамкой элемента. Свойство воспринимает величины для каждой стороны раздельно или единое для всех сторон. Увеличение padding расширяет суммарный величину элемента.

Рамка border окружает элемент отображаемой полосой. Параметр border совмещает ширину, тип и цвет границы. Доступны разные виды: solid, dashed, dotted и другие опции в rox casino.

Внешний интервал margin определяет интервал между блоками на странице. Отрицательные значения margin стягивают блоки. Атрибут box-sizing со значением border-box добавляет padding и border в указанные width и height.

Основы формирования: инлайновые и блочные элементы, flexbox/простая разметка для начинающих

HTML-элементы делятся на блочные и строчные по способу представления. Блочные элементы занимают всю наличную ширину и начинаются с новой линии. Строчные элементы располагаются в потоке текста и захватывают исключительно необходимое пространство.

Свойство display меняет вид представления элемента. Значение block трансформирует элемент в блочный, а inline делает строчным. Значение inline-block сочетает свойства обоих типов.

Flexbox предоставляет механизм для построения гибких компоновок. Блок с display: flex трансформирует внутренние элементы в flex-элементы. Ориентация расположения определяется параметром flex-direction.

Ключевые атрибуты flexbox для распределения:

  • justify-content выравнивает элементы по центральной линии
  • align-items регулирует распределением по вторичной оси
  • flex-wrap даёт элементам перемещаться на свежую линию
  • gap образует отступы между flex-элементами

Элементарная компоновка стартует с понимания потока документа. Элементы размещаются сверху книзу и слева направо. Flexbox упрощает создание отзывчивых схем в рокс казино.

Упражнение для начинающих: разработка простой страницы и последовательное улучшение с средствами CSS

Создание начальной веб-страницы стартует с фундаментального HTML-шаблона. Документ содержит декларацию DOCTYPE, блоки head и body с минимальным контентом. Простая страница охватывает название, абзацы текста и рисунок.

Стартовый этап оформления — подсоединение внешнего файла CSS к документу. Сгенерируйте файл styles.css и присоедините его через тег link. Приступите с базовых конфигураций: задайте гарнитуру для страницы и цвет фона body.

Дальнейший шаг — дизайн текста и цветовой палитры. Задайте величины и оттенки названий, установите межстрочное промежуток для параграфов. Примените выразительные цвета для повышения восприятия.

Манипуляция с интервалами формирует визуальную композицию. Установите наибольшую ширину контейнера и центрируйте содержимое через margin: auto. Добавьте внутренние отбивки padding вокруг элементов в казино рокс.

Последние улучшения охватывают дизайн гиперссылок и hover-эффектов. Смените оттенок линков и уберите подчёркивание. Задействуйте border-radius для закругления углов изображений. Экспериментируйте с разными параметрами для осознания их влияния.

Share this post